技术文摘
python爬虫网站的使用方法
python爬虫网站的使用方法
在当今信息爆炸的时代,数据的获取和分析变得愈发重要。Python爬虫网站作为一种强大的工具,能够帮助我们高效地从互联网上收集所需信息。下面就来介绍一下Python爬虫网站的使用方法。
要掌握基本的Python知识。Python是一种简洁、易学的编程语言,拥有丰富的库和工具,为爬虫开发提供了便利。在开始爬虫项目前,需要安装相关的库,如BeautifulSoup、Scrapy等。这些库可以帮助我们解析网页内容、提取数据以及进行网络请求。
接下来,确定目标网站。在选择目标网站时,要确保自己的行为符合法律法规和网站的使用规则。了解目标网站的结构和数据分布情况是至关重要的。可以通过查看网页源代码、分析网页链接等方式来熟悉网站的结构。
然后,编写爬虫代码。使用Python编写爬虫代码时,首先要发送HTTP请求获取网页内容。可以使用requests库来实现这一步骤。获取到网页内容后,使用BeautifulSoup等解析库对网页进行解析,通过定位标签、属性等方式提取出我们需要的数据。
在编写代码过程中,要注意处理可能出现的异常情况,如网络连接失败、页面不存在等。合理设置请求头和请求间隔,避免对目标网站造成过大的压力,同时也能降低被封禁的风险。
另外,数据的存储和处理也是重要的环节。可以将爬取到的数据存储到文件中,如CSV、JSON等格式,方便后续的分析和处理。也可以将数据存入数据库,以便进行更复杂的查询和管理。
最后,测试和优化爬虫程序。在实际运行爬虫程序之前,进行充分的测试,检查是否能够正确地爬取到数据以及数据的准确性。根据测试结果对程序进行优化,提高爬虫的效率和稳定性。
Python爬虫网站的使用需要一定的技术基础和实践经验。通过不断学习和尝试,我们可以利用它获取到有价值的数据,为自己的工作和研究提供支持。
- 鸿蒙 JS 开发 7:鸿蒙分组列表与弹出 Menu 菜单
- 鸿蒙通信开发中 Wi-Fi IoT 套件与 PCF8563 联合实现电子钟功能
- 编程初学者怎样学习编程更高效
- 中台之后 微服务是否也会走向末路?
- Laravel 与 Vue.js 缘何成为强大组合
- C# 8 中默认接口方法的使用方式
- 令人意想不到,日志竟能如此分析!
- ECharts 饼图与环形图绘制教程:手把手教学
- Overriding:11 条规则,偏不告诉你
- 独家报道:lock.lock() 能否写在 try 外面?
- 侧边栏导航组件的实现之思
- JS 中检查对象是否为数组的方法
- 源码剖析:虚拟 DOM 算法的实现之道
- LeetCode 中两个有序链表的合并题解
- 掌握 C 指针的这些使用技巧,实现能力飞跃